Double-glazed windows

Double-glazed windows are the most efficient choice to boost your home's energy efficiency. They are extremely effective in stopping the loss of heat during winter and ensuring that your home stays cool in the summer. They also aid in reducing noise pollution and increase the overall security of your home.

Double-glazed windows have an air gap sealed between them that acts as an insulation layer. This helps to reduce the flow of heat. This effect of insulation helps reduce your energy costs and makes your home more comfortable.

Another great feature of double-glazed windows is that they prevent condensation. This means that your home is less likely to be a victim of mould, which can be an illness risk and could result in a build-up of dampness.

Additionally they also provide the benefit of reducing the carbon footprint of your home by helping to reduce your energy usage. They are a green option and can substantially improve the value of your home.

Bay windows

Bay windows are a timeless style that can completely transform the look of your home. They can improve the curb appeal, boost natural light and views, as well as increase the square footage of your living space. Additionally, they are an excellent way to add seating and storage to your home.

Bay windows are available in a variety of styles and configurations, so it is important to select a style that matches the architecture and style of your home. These window styles include bow windows and canted bay windows.

Canted bay windows typically feature a fixed window in the front, and two flanking windows that are angled at 30 to 40 degrees. They are typically designed for the first floor.

These bay windows are often found on Victorian homes due to their decorative motifs. They are also used on other types of homes.

The sides of bay windows are usually shorter than the front, which can be advantageous for ventilation. They can also be used for display purposes for example, such as displaying flowers or decorative pieces on the ledge.
